Lyons Park is a charming neighborhood nestled in the southeast part of Mobile, AL, known for its welcoming community vibe and a blend of historic and modern homes. If you’re considering relocating here, you’ll find a peaceful residential setting perfect for families, professionals, and retirees alike. The neighborhood is especially appreciated for its tree-lined streets and well-maintained parks, offering plenty of green space for outdoor activities and leisurely strolls. Lyons Park’s unique mix of architecture, ranging from cozy bungalows to larger craftsman-style houses, gives the area a distinctive character that residents take pride in.

One of the standout attractions in Lyons Park is the beautiful Leroy Stevens Park, which serves as a local hub for recreation and community events. The park features playgrounds, walking trails, and picnic areas, making it a favorite destination for residents looking to enjoy some fresh air and sunshine without venturing far from home. Additionally, the neighborhood is home to several quaint cafes and boutique shops that provide a touch of local flavor and convenience. For those who appreciate arts and culture, Lyons Park is just a short drive from the Mobile Museum of Art and the Mobile Carnival Museum, enriching the community with creative and historical experiences.

When it comes to accessibility, Lyons Park is conveniently located approximately 10 to 15 minutes from Downtown Mobile. This close proximity means residents can easily enjoy the vibrant downtown scene, including excellent dining, live music venues, and waterfront parks along the Mobile River. Whether you’re commuting to work or planning a fun weekend outing, the neighborhood’s location offers the perfect balance of suburban tranquility and urban excitement. Lyons Park Demographics

Population 1,650
Density (People/sqml.) 2,632
Median Age 37.7
Married Couples
35%
35% of the population of Lyons Park aged 16 years and older are married.
Have Kids
22%
22% of the population aged 16 years or older have children.

About 35% of the Lyons Park population aged 16 and older are married, which is notably lower than average. Housing

? /10
Home Price $186,178
Median Rent $903
People/Household 2.4

Home Price Breakdown

Lyons Park neighborhood home price breakdown chart

Rent vs Own

Rent 58% Own 42%

Year Moved In

Before 2010 73% After 2010 27%

Housing trends offer valuable insight into the accessibility and character of a neighborhood. In Lyons Park, the median home price is $186,178, which is less than many surrounding areas. This affordability makes it an attractive option for first-time buyers, young families, or anyone looking to enter the housing market without a significant financial barrier.
